Press the PROG button to display the program playback window , 20 tracks or chapters can be programmed . 2 . Press the buttons to select your desired track/ title / chapter and then press the ENTER button to confirm . 3 .

The Card Reader & USB Funcion Operation Digital Output 1. Off: Does not output digital signal. 2. PCM: Converts to PCM(2CH) 48KHz audio. Select PCM when using the Analog Audio Output. 3. RAW:Outputs Bitstream through the digital output without any conversion.
